21
Esta formação é voltada a profissionais da área da tecnologia da informação que desejam obter ou atualizar seus conhecimentos sobre o desenvolvimento de aplicações WEB e DESKTOP utilizando a plataforma MICROSOFT .NET 4.0 e os padrões mais conhecidos de mercado. Desenvolvedor .NET 4.0

T@rget trust microsoft asp.net mvc

Embed Size (px)

DESCRIPTION

 

Citation preview

Page 1: T@rget trust   microsoft asp.net mvc

Esta formação é voltada a profissionais da área da tecnologia da informação que desejam obter ou atualizar seus conhecimentos sobre o desenvolvimento de aplicações WEB e DESKTOP utilizando a plataforma MICROSOFT .NET 4.0 e os padrões mais conhecidos de mercado.

Desenvolvedor .NET 4.0

Page 2: T@rget trust   microsoft asp.net mvc

O ASP.NET é a plataforma da Microsoft para o desenvolvimento de aplicações Web que permite através de uma linguagem de programação integrada na .NET Framework criar páginas dinâmicas. As aplicações para essa plataforma podem ser escritas em várias linguagens, como C# e Visual Basic .NET.

Desenvolvedor .NET 4.0

Page 3: T@rget trust   microsoft asp.net mvc

O ambiente de desenvolvimento utilizado nesta formação é o Visual Studio .NET que possui diversas características que facilitam o trabalho do programador, como os componentes visuais para criação de formulários de páginas Web.

Desenvolvedor .NET 4.0

Page 4: T@rget trust   microsoft asp.net mvc

Hoje o mercado demanda muito por profissionais com conhecimento nesta tecnologia, uma vez que a mesma está presente em muitos ambientes corporativos e que necessitam de Aplicações Web dinâmicas e com performance. Nesta formação voce irá adquirir os conhecimentos para entrar neste mercado.

Desenvolvedor .NET 4.0

Page 5: T@rget trust   microsoft asp.net mvc

Tecnologias: .Net 4.0 , Web Developer

Duração: 160h

Desenvolvedor .NET 4.0

Page 6: T@rget trust   microsoft asp.net mvc

Orientação a Objetos com UML Duração 20h C# 4.0 - Fundamentos da Linguagem Duração 20h ASP.NET Duração 20h ASP.NET Avançado Duração 20h

CURSOS

Desenvolvedor .NET 4.0

Page 7: T@rget trust   microsoft asp.net mvc

Windows Forms com Visual Studio 2010 Duração 20h LINQ - Language Integrated Query Duração 20h Microsoft Asp.Net MVC Duração 20h Crystal Reports - Geração de Relatórios Duração 20h

CURSOS

Desenvolvedor .NET 4.0

Page 8: T@rget trust   microsoft asp.net mvc

Microsoft Asp.Net MVC Explicar o funcionamento do padrão MVC e sua aplicação no desenvolvimento de software. - Capacitar o aluno a desenvolver uma aplicação usando este framework da Microsoft, orientando sobre a forma de obter-se uma maior produtividade e qualidade de código.

Page 9: T@rget trust   microsoft asp.net mvc

Microsoft Asp.Net MVC - Programar utilizando Orientação a Objetos através de C# e jQuery para tornar a aplicação dinâmica e rica.

Duração: 20h

Page 10: T@rget trust   microsoft asp.net mvc

Objetivos

- Explicar o Asp.Net MVC, que é um framework da Microsoft que aplica o padrão MVC- Dar condições de o aluno entender o funcionamento do framework para tirar maior proveito da sua arquitetura- Contextualizar a utilização do framework, observando dificuldades encontradas e soluções possíveis- Explicar o padrão MVC

Pré-requisitos

- Curso T@rgetTrust Introdução a Banco de Dados Relacional ou conhecimento equivalente- Curso T@rgetTrust Padrões WEB 2.0 com XHTML e CSS - Curso T@rgetTrust Orientação a Objetos com UML - Conhecimentos de Lógica de Programação (curso T@rgetTrust Lógica de Progamação)

Microsoft Asp.Net MVC

Page 11: T@rget trust   microsoft asp.net mvc

Público alvo

- Arquitetos de Sistemas e Projetistas- Desenvolvedores de Aplicações- Gerentes de Sistemas- Web Developers- Analistas de Sistemas

Microsoft Asp.Net MVC

Page 12: T@rget trust   microsoft asp.net mvc

Conteúdo

1. O Padrão

- Objetivos- Responsabilidades dentro do MVC- Aplicação no desenvolvimento de software- Vantagens- Desvantagens

2. O Framework Asp. Net MVC

- Objetivos- Histórico de lançamentos- Preparando o Visual Studio- Criando um novo projeto

Microsoft Asp.Net MVC

Page 13: T@rget trust   microsoft asp.net mvc

3. Controllers

- Objetivos- A estrutura- Tipos de retorno

4. Views

- Objetivos- A estrutura- Modelo de página padrão- Como fazer?

5. Áreas

- Objetivos- Estrutura

Microsoft Asp.Net MVC

Page 14: T@rget trust   microsoft asp.net mvc

6. Rotas

- Objetivos- Estrutura

7. Model e ViewModel

- Objetivos- Conhecendo o Model- Conhecendo o ViewModel- Validação no "cliente" com Data Annotations

Microsoft Asp.Net MVC

Page 15: T@rget trust   microsoft asp.net mvc

8. Helpers

- Objetivos- O que são Helpers- Html Helper- Criando um helper

9. Razor

- Objetivos- Helpers com Razor- Function com Razor- Adicionando comentários

Microsoft Asp.Net MVC

Page 16: T@rget trust   microsoft asp.net mvc

10. Segurança

- Objetivos- Segurança no Asp. Net MVC- AntiForgeryToken- Authorize

11. Filtros Globais

- Objetivos- O que é um filtro global- Utilizando filtros globais

Microsoft Asp.Net MVC

Page 17: T@rget trust   microsoft asp.net mvc

12. DataBind

- Objetivos- O que é databind automático

13. Testes

- Objetivos- Asp. Net MVC e Testes- Modelo de testes

Microsoft Asp.Net MVC

Page 18: T@rget trust   microsoft asp.net mvc

14. Arquitetura

- Objetivos- Impacto da arquitetura em um projeto MVC- Por onde começar- Problemas com indefinições na arquitetura- Conclusão

Microsoft Asp.Net MVC

Page 19: T@rget trust   microsoft asp.net mvc

TECNOLOGIAS E CURSOS

PHP.NetJavaAdobe FlexWeb DesignDesign Gráfico

Testes de SoftwareMetodologias ÁgeisAnálise de SistemasRequisitos de SoftwareGestão de Projetos PMI/PMPGestão de Serviços ITIL V3Gestão Estratégica com BSC

RailsLinuxOracleWeb 2.0C e C++PostgreSQL

Page 20: T@rget trust   microsoft asp.net mvc

CLIENTES

Page 21: T@rget trust   microsoft asp.net mvc

www.targettrust.com.br